Hello, I'm a new subscriber, and have just resonantly found your channel. I could use a little help with my setup. I'm currently running a 4 bulb T5ho fixture at 54w a piece, along with a fluval 2.0 59w fixture on my 75 gallon aquarium. I tried years ago to run the tank on two of the fluval 2.0's and wean myself off of the t5ho's as they are getting harder to find replacement components for as things break. With just the two Fluval led fixtures I started losing plants at the lower levels of the tank, do to the light not penetrating enough and the base stems started rotting away. My substrate is three to four inches of Seachem red flourite. I have soft water which goes from 6.8 - 7.1 ph, and is filtered through an Eheim 2075 Professional 3. I'm injecting C02 through an inline atomizer at about 2 to 3 bubbles per second, controlled buy a ph meter. The C02 starts 30 minutes before the lights, and shuts off 30 minutes before the lights. I run my lights for 10 hours a day which seems to work best after experimenting for a while, and this tank has been up and running for 6 years now. I've had varying success over the year, and I'm interested to know the amount, and frequency of your fertilization regiment, also your lighting equipment, and run times. I have great success with just about all of the fast growing stem plants I've tried, but struggle with slower growing, and broader leafed plants. I hardly use any ferts. If I try a regiment of more than one pump a week of the aquarium co-op product easy green, or other ferts such as Thrive, I start having algae issues. I've found it hard to find good advice on larger tanks, and was glad to come across you channel. Could you possibly take a moment to give me you thoughts on my setup, and any suggestions you may have? Thank you for any help, and I enjoy your informative videos greatly.
